Introduktion til Python IDE til Windows

Python IDE til Windows, Python er et af de stort set anvendte programmeringssprog, der bruges til webudvikling på grund af dets enkelhed og avancerede funktioner. At skrive Python-kode ved hjælp af Python-shell er noget trættende og frustrerende til tider, når det kommer til at arbejde på store projekter. På den anden side gør IDE (Integrated Development Environment) programmering let og sjovt, da det inkluderer kodeditor, plugins til forskellige formål, værktøjer til komplet udførelse og fejlsøgning af koden.

Python IDE til Windows

Nogle af de almindeligt tilgængelige Python IDE'er på markedet er beskrevet nedenfor:

1. Sublim tekst 3

Sublime Text er en af ​​de meget anvendte kodeditorer til Python-programmering. Bortset fra Python giver det støtte til en lang række sprog. Det har indbygget support til Python og tillader udvidelse ved hjælp af pakkerne til fejlsøgning og kodning. En af fordelene ved at bruge den sublime tekst til Python-programmering er, at den er hurtig og meget tilpasselig og har et stort samfund af tilhængere. Selvom evalueringsversionen af ​​den kan bruges i en hvilken som helst lang periode, skal man købe den betalte version for at bruge de avancerede funktioner.

2. PyCharm

PyCharm anses for at være en af ​​de bedste IDE-er, der bruges af professionen Python-udviklere, da det hjælper dem med at være mere produktive og skrive en pæn og let vedligeholdelig kode. Det leveres med smarte funktioner som indbygget debugger, online kodeditor, automatisk kodekonfiguration, fejldetektering osv. Så udvikleren behøver ikke at gøre noget andet, det kan bare begynde at skrive Python-koden i den nye fil. Det tillader tværplatformudvikling af applikationen, hvilket er meget nyttigt for udviklerne. Det giver mulighed for tilpasning af grænsefladen, som igen hjælper med at øge den samlede produktivitet. PyCharm er en letvægts-IDE og har stor community support. Den eneste ulempe er, at det er ret dyrt og sommetider hænger, hvis systemet har mindre hukommelse.

3. Formørkelse med Pydev

Hvis du er en programmør, skal du have hørt meget om Eclipse. Eclipse IDE bruges dybest set til Java-udvikling, men det giver en særlig funktion ved at tilføje flere tilføjelser og udvidelser. Pydev er også en udvidelse, der bruges i Eclipse til Python-udviklingen og giver en interaktiv konsol, let fejlsøgning, automatisk kodekonfiguration osv. Det giver de specielle egenskaber ved tip, analyse af kode og kodeindmontering. Når den først er installeret i Eclipse, tillader den hurtigere og hurtig udførelse af kode sammen med nogle stærke funktioner i syntaksbelysning og parsingfejl. En af ulemperne ved at arbejde i PyCharm ved hjælp af Eclipse er, at til den store applikation er der en masse plugins at håndtere, nogle gange bliver det vanskeligt at håndtere alt i et enkelt projekt, og IDE hænger også til tider.

4. Spyder

Spyder er en af ​​de mest berømte IDE på markedet, når det kommer til Python-udvikling. Det er en af ​​de avancerede IDE'er og bruges hovedsageligt af datavidenskabsmændene og ingeniørerne, da det giver nogle specielle funktioner ved udforskning af data bortset fra at tilvejebringe de normale funktioner, der ligner de fleste af IDE'erne som kodeditor, debugger og syntaksbelysning. Det fungerer fantastisk med de flersprogede redaktører og giver kraftfuld integration med iPython-konsollen. Det tillader brugen af ​​udvidede plugins for at have mere specielle og ekstraordinære funktioner. Det understøtter en meget flot debugger, der kan spore endda et enkelt trin i koden. En af ulemperne med Syder er, at når flere plugins tilføjes og påberåbes på samme tid, reduceres dens ydelse.

5. Vinge

Vingen er også en af ​​de populære IDE'er i dag, da den giver nogle specielle funktioner, der gør koden hurtigere og Python-programmering let og nøjagtig. Det hjælper med testdrevet udvikling af integration med kraftfulde rammer som Django, pytest osv., Der er trend i disse dage. Det giver nogle ekstra funktioner som en ekstra fane til undtagelseshåndtering, som hjælper programmereren med let at debugging af kode, browser, der viser alle variablerne på et enkelt sted osv. En af ulemperne ved at bruge Wing er, at det kun giver 30 dage prøveversion og den betalte version af den er ret dyr.

6. IDLE

IDLE anses for at være den bedste IDE for begyndere i Python. Det er skrevet i Python selv og en tværplatform IDE, der gør udviklingen let og fleksibel. Dens debugger er meget kraftfuld med kontinuerlige breakpoints. Det understøtter tekstvindue med flere vinduer, automatisk kodekonfiguration, syntaksbelysning osv. IDLE har nogle specielle funktioner som det giver programmereren mulighed for at søge gennem flere filer og det i ethvert vindue. Den eneste ulempe ved IDLE er, at den ikke er egnet til programmer på højt niveau og mangler nogle interface-problemer, som er meget grundlæggende i en IDE.

7. Eric

Eric er en kraftfuld IDE til Python-udviklere. Det er en open-source, tværplatform og IDE med fuldt udstyr, som kan bruges dagligt af udviklerne. Eric IDE er udviklet på en sådan måde, at den også kan bruges af studerende, begyndere og fagfolk. Det understøtter nogle funktioner på højt niveau som fildetektering, syntaksbelysning og automatisk færdiggørelse af kode. Det understøtter også indbygget debugger, kodedækning og opgavehåndtering. Det tillader integreret enhedstest, versionskontrol og flersproget UI. Det har et pluginsystem, som gør det muligt at udvide til den nyeste funktion i IDE. En ulempe ved at bruge Eric er nogle gange, det bliver svært at styre, når det kommer til meget store projekter med masser af plugins.

Konklusion-Python IDE til Windows

Ovenstående forklaring beskriver nogle af de mest kraftfulde og populære IDE'er til Python på markedet. Hver IDE har nogle fordele og ulemper. Det er meget vigtigt at vælge en idol-tilpasset IDE i henhold til projektkrav, virksomhedspolitikker og projektbudget. Husk forskellige parametre og efter komplet analyse, skal en IDE vælges af et team til at starte med ethvert projekt.

Anbefalede artikler

Dette er en guide til Python IDE til Windows. Her diskuterer vi de mest kraftfulde og populære IDE'er for Python på markedet. Du kan også gennemgå vores andre relaterede artikler for at lære mere -

  1. Bedste Java IDE
  2. Installer Selenium IDE
  3. Hvad er IDE?
  4. Installer Python på Windows
  5. Python-funktioner
  6. Kode dækning vs test dækning | Top 4 forskelle at lære
  7. Kode dækningsværktøjer | Top 6 kode dækningsværktøjer

Kategori: